深入了解网络抓包神器Wireshark
Wireshark是一个网络协议分析工具,也是一种网络抓包工具。它可以帮助我们捕获并分析网络中的数据包,从而了解网络中传输的数据、协议等信息。在网络工程师的日常工作中,Wireshark是一个必备的工具之一。
Wireshark的优点在于它可以捕获和解析多种协议的数据包。比如说HTTP、FTP、SMTP、TCP、UDP等等。它能够将这些协议的数据包进行解析,显示出每个数据包的具体信息,例如数据包的源地址、目的地址、传输协议、数据长度、数据内容等等。这些信息对于分析网络问题、排除故障非常有用。
除此之外,Wireshark还支持过滤功能,可以根据自己的需求设置过滤条件,只显示符合条件的数据包,从而帮助我们快速定位问题。比如说,我们可以设置过滤条件只显示某个IP地址的数据包,或者只显示某种协议的数据包等等。这些过滤条件可以大大简化我们的分析工作。
当然,使用Wireshark需要一定的网络知识和技能。首先,我们需要了解一些基本的网络协议知识,例如TCP/IP协议、HTTP协议、FTP协议等等。其次,我们需要掌握一些基本的Wireshark操作技巧,例如如何启动Wireshark、如何设置捕获过滤条件、如何分析数据包等等。
在日常工作中,我们可以利用Wireshark帮助我们解决各种网络问题,例如网络延迟、网络拥塞、网络故障等等。通过Wireshark捕获和分析数据包,我们可以更加深入地了解网络中的各种问题,从而提高我们的解决问题能力和技能水平。
总之,Wireshark是一款非常实用的网络抓包工具,它能够帮助我们深入了解网络中传输的数据和协议,从而解决各种网络问题。作为一名网络工程师,掌握Wireshark的使用技巧是必不可少的。